To commemorate the launch of Coca-Cola Life, its first new product in eight years since Coca-Cola Zero, The Coca-Cola Company held a PR event on March 12 at Omotesando Hills in Shibuya, Tokyo.
A giant infiorata (Italian for "flower carpet") made from herbs such as stevia was installed on the grand staircase at the event venue, and actress Yoshino Kimura completed the bottle design by adding the final seedling.

Launched to mark the 100th anniversary of the Coca-Cola bottle, Coca-Cola Life is a health-conscious carbonated beverage that combines reduced calories with the familiar Coca-Cola taste by using sugar and a plant-based sweetener extracted from stevia leaves. It was named based on the concept of encouraging adults who are interested in health and have a positive outlook on aging to enjoy their "life." The use of green on the label is also new.
